Telnet是一种基于文本的网络协议,用于远程登录到计算机系统,并在本地终端上执行命令。虽然Telnet是一个方便的工具,在早期互联网的发展中被广泛采用,但由于其不安全的特性,越来越多的Linux管理员们选择禁用Telnet服务,以增加系统的安全性。
禁用Telnet服务可以有效防止潜在的网络攻击,因为Telnet在传输过程中使用的是明文传输,不对传输的数据进行加密。这意味着在网络传输过程中,攻击者可以轻松窃取用户的用户名和密码等敏感信息,从而危害系统的安全。相比之下,SSH(Secure Shell)是一种更加安全和加密的远程登录协议,许多Linux管理员更倾向于使用SSH来替代Telnet以确保系统安全。
在Linux系统中,禁用Telnet服务通常可以通过修改系统的配置文件来实现。管理员可以编辑/etc/inetd.conf或/etc/xinetd.d/telnet等文件,将Telnet相关的行注释掉或删除。此外,在防火墙设置中,管理员还应确保禁止Telnet端口(通常是端口23)对外开放,以杜绝潜在的网络攻击。
另外,管理员还可以通过安装一些网络安全工具来监控系统的安全状态,及时发现潜在的安全威胁。例如,Fail2ban是一个可以监控登录失败次数并自动封禁攻击者IP地址的工具,可以帮助管理员防范暴力破解和其他网络攻击。
总的来说,禁用Telnet服务是一项重要的安全措施,可以提高Linux系统的安全性,保护系统免受潜在的网络攻击。管理员们应该时刻关注系统的安全配置,并定期审查和更新系统的安全措施,确保系统在网络空间中的安全性和稳定性。